Menu:

Appetizer:

  • Fig-ricotta-mint on pumpernickel.

I got these little pumpernickel toasts and piled them with fresh ricotta cheese, mint leaves and pieces of fresh fig (they’re in season! Go guy some!). Soooo good – the ricotta-mint-fig combination is one of my favorites, and also constituted my sandwich for lunch today. Next time it could do with less heavy pumpernickel toasts though – the flavor worked but the bread was so dense that it got to be a little overwhelming.


Main Course:

  • Roasted butternut squash
  • Sweet pea-corn crab salad
  • Orange-fennel-parmesan salad on mixed greens

Squash: Sorry, no pictures of the roasted squash! But – just cut those babies in half, scoop out the seeds, put them on a pan face up, fill the middles with olive oil, crushed sage, beer (yes beer! Usually I use butter and vegetable broth but 1) there was a vegan coming and 2) I didn’t have any broth, but I did have a negro modelo. It worked well!), salt and pepper, cover with tin foil and roast at 400 degrees for 30-45 minutes. Then cool, scoop, mash and serve. Mmmmmm.

Sweet pea and corn crab salad: Sooo loosely based on a Mark Bittman recipe that was in the times a while ago, but I added/changed some stuff. I used: ¾ of a large red onion, 2 small red peppers, one orange pepper, 4 ears of fresh corn (cook it, then cut the kernels off and add), 2 avocados, about 1 lb of sweet peas, shelled (no actually I’m making that up and have no idea how many I used. But it was a bunch. Take them out of their shells and poach them in saltwater for about 30 seconds before using – otherwise they’re not so sweet), and three 8-oz containers of packed crab meat. Dice everything that doesn’t come in bite size pieces, and make a dressing out of olive oil, lemon salt and pepper. Oh! And also chop up some basil. Mix everything together and eat.

Orange fennel parmesan salad on mixed greens: get mixed greens. Wash them. Put them in a salad bowl. Chop fennel. Add it. Chop orange slices into bite size pieces (no pits! This can be difficult actually if you don’t know how to do it – I learned from Jamie Oliver). Add them. Shave parmesan on top. I forgot the dressing for this so used Newman’s own, but think some kind of lemony-dijon thing would be nice.


Dessert:

  • Thyme-Fruit salad and Frommage Blanc.

Fruit salad: Blueberries, chopped nectarines, bananas. Make a dressing out of the juice of 3-4 limes, and a few tablespoons of honey and the leaves from like 6 fresh thyme sprigs. Mix. Yum.
